About the "Using Images" Worksheet

This interactive and printable worksheet titled "Using Images" from workybooks.com is designed to engage young learners in matching sentences to corresponding images. The worksheet presents four simple sentences, each accompanied by a visual representation, encouraging children to make connections between the written word and the visual cue.

The worksheet covers a range of topics, including a monkey's love for fruit, a magical fairy, a frog sitting on a lily pad, and a person driving a fire truck. By completing this activity, children will develop their observation skills, language comprehension, and the ability to associate written descriptions with their visual counterparts.

Common core standards covered

RL.K.7
With prompting and support, describe the relationship between illustrations and the story in which they appear (e.g., what moment in a story an illustration depicts).
